Located in Kilindoni and only 6.1 km from Rufiji Mafia Kilwa Marine Reserve, Maweni CoralBay Beach Villa provides accommodation with sea views, free WiFi and free private parking.
Celeste
Spain
Lovely location just on the beach with great sunsets. Good breakfast. Very good WiFi in common areas and rooms.
Staff always friendly and available. Thank you Mudrick and Ramla! Also Baja the manager was easily accessible through WhatsApp.
Bar open pretty much all day. And hot water for tea or coffee always available.
Walking distance to airport, ferry, town centre and can walk for hours along the beach either way.
Snorkeling from shore to see starfish, jelly fish and sea cucumbers and 2 monkeys passed through the hotel while we were there.
Offer whale shark tours though their sister hotel.
Good value for money.
Set 7.7 km from Rufiji Mafia Kilwa Marine Reserve, kua garden cottage offers accommodation with free WiFi and free private parking. This bed and breakfast provides a bar.
Mirko
Italy
Food is amazing and the owner is doing his best to make your holiday nice!
Boasting garden views, Mafia Island Bungalows offers accommodation with a garden and a balcony, around 6.1 km from Rufiji Mafia Kilwa Marine Reserve.
Lisel
Australia
The service and staff were wonderful, very attentive and helpful. Free bikes so we could go into Utende which is 10 minutes away. Very nice gardens and grounds. Comfortable and nicely decorated rooms. Great food and juices. Only 2 rooms so feels boutique.
With sea views, Mafia Beach Bungalows sea view is located in Utende and has a restaurant, a 24-hour front desk, bar, garden, sun terrace and outdoor fireplace.
Corinne
Switzerland
- One of the most delicious food I've ever eaten
- Fresh fruits
- Very nice stuff
- Nice activities
Boasting a garden and views of quiet street, Mafia Neptune Villa Lodge is a recently renovated bed and breakfast situated in Utende, 7.5 km from Rufiji Mafia Kilwa Marine Reserve.
Max
Germany
The chef prepared an awesome breakfast and can makes great mishkaki and samosas. The rooms are very clean and have air condition. The staff is always ready to help with any situation and the manager speaks English.
For travellers who enjoy beauty in the simple things, a bed and breakfast (B&B) is the perfect place for a getaway. Hosts welcome guests into their homes and provide a private room and complimentary breakfast. Bathrooms may be shared by other guests, and there is often shared space with the host.
Beautiful new and well appointed hotel. Crisp laundry and spotless towels. Attentive and helpful staff. Beautiful infinity pool overlooking the sea. A place for peace and quiet - esp beach combing and bird watching along the mangrove fringed shore.
Ally is a very good host that tries his best to help and make you feel at home. I had the room with own bathroom and it was big and comfy. Staff makes really nice food. A bit of a walk to the nice beaches but cheap to go there by motorbike. Friendly people in the lokal area. Definitely one of the cheapest accommodation around. Buy a local SIM to have access to the Internet. Cold showers. Tours can be booked from here.
Bunda and Ally are great hosts! They are always there to help you if you have any question!
The kitchen can be used to prepare your own meals, as well they have a menu in case you would like to order dinner.
Beautifully maintained, green and peaceful, very very kind and helpful staff, care for nature and animals (Pablo the dog was cute and friendly as well), well decorated, easy to move around with tuktuk, local beach nearby... and we were almost the only ones staying, so it was pleasant and quiet
Mr Ally Mgeni and his team were super nice and super helpful from the beginning, also with supporting the transport by public ferry which is not so easy to handle as a non local.
Had a nice stay in this quite area which is though in walking distance to the airport and to the city center
I absolutely loved the beach front location, my comfortable bungalow and the friendliness of the staff. I was impressed by how they were able to organize everything without me searching for the whale sharks safari boat trip, diving and private boda-bod drivers to explore the island. Everything was taken care of.
Special thanks to Francesca - a beautiful soul - who was there for me every time I needed advice, help or just a chat. You are a truly amazing young lady!
Best to All,
Kinga from Poland
1. Staff: all are very friendly, nice and helpful. Major plus for this place and they have taken good care of us. THANKS!
2. Proximity to the beach, strolling along the beach during sunset has been really relaxing and the views were great
3. Great whaleshark snorkeling tour with Captain Kino. Swam with lots of whalesharks and the price is better than other places too. Don't miss this!
4. Food and drinks of the restaurant are much cheaper than nearby places and are of good quality.
5. Spacious room
it’s private, spacious and fits well with the nature. The bed is comfortable, staff vas very nice and yummy food. There is a choice of fresh seafood for lunch and dinner and fresh fruits available. Th ask pretty much all what we eaten the whole time and was really delicious. There is also a bar and bed hammocks which was great for relaxing. Hassan the host Organise a whale shark tour for us which we really enjoyed as that was the main reason. for visiting Mafia.
Milena
Young couple
Research, refine and make plans for your whole trip
We have more than 70 million property reviews, and they're all from real, verified guests.
How does it work?
1
It starts with a booking
It starts with a booking
The only way to leave a review is to first make a booking. That's how we know our reviews come from real guests who have stayed at the property.
2
Followed by a trip
Followed by a trip
When guests stay at the property they check out how quiet the room is, how friendly the staff are and more.
3
And finally, a review
And finally, a review
After their trip, guests tell us about their stay. We check for naughty words and verify the authenticity of all guest reviews before adding them to our site.
If you booked through us and want to leave a review, please sign in first.